An invalid enumeration string was supplied.

QuickBooks Desktop (Pro, Premier or Enterprise)
If you are exporting or deleting deposits and receive the error below continue reading for a solution:

Error in frmMain: Function GetDeposits
Line 2670 An invalid enumeration string was supplied
(Error #-2147220496)

If you receive this error when either using the Transaction Pro Exporter or Deleter it is due to the fact that your QuickBooks file has invalid data in it specifically a negative deposit.  You need to either change the sign on this deposit in QuickBooks or delete in manually.

You can also refer to this Intuit article for more information:

Add Feedback